#7b3d8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7b3d8f is composed of 48.2% red, 23.9%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 285.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 40%. #7b3d8f color hex could be obtained by blending #f67aff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7b3d8f color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#7b3d8f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7b3d8f has RGB values of R:123, G:61,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8076687.

Shades and Tints of #7b3d8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#faf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b3d8f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676468 is the less saturated color, while #9706c6 is the most saturated one.
